Letters from Togo

Letters from Togo

Author(s): Susan Blake

Location(s): Togo, Lome

Genre(s): Autobiography/Memoirs

Era(s): Contemporary

Blake’s adventurous essays are based on the letters she wrote home to her friends while in Lome, Togo, the West African capital where she taught American Literature. As Blake begins the process of making sense out of a vibrant, seeming anarchy, we are pulled along with her into the heart of Togo – a tiny, dry strip of a country no one can even find on a map.
